The comparison between Zscaler Zero Trust Network Access and OpenSSH is particularly intriguing due to their shared focus on enhancing security in network access, albeit through different methodologies. Zscaler Zero Trust Network Access excels in providing a comprehensive zero-trust architecture that is cloud-delivered, allowing enterprises to enforce strict access controls and visibility across hybrid and multi-cloud environments. This service is particularly beneficial for organizations that require advanced threat protection and granular access management, which is vital in today's landscape of increasing cyber threats.

On the other hand, OpenSSH stands out as a robust implementation of the SSH protocol, primarily designed for secure remote login and data transfer. Its strengths lie in features such as public key authentication and port forwarding, making it an ideal choice for enterprises that prioritize secure shell access and file transfers. When comparing the two, Zscaler Zero Trust Network Access offers a more holistic approach to network security, while OpenSSH provides a more focused solution for secure communications.

The trade-off here is clear: Zscaler is better suited for organizations needing extensive security measures across various applications, while OpenSSH is perfect for those who require a straightforward, secure method for remote access. Ultimately, the choice between the two will depend on the specific security needs of the organization, with Zscaler Zero Trust Network Access being the preferred option for enterprises seeking comprehensive security solutions, and OpenSSH being ideal for those focused on secure remote access.

description Overview

OpenSSH

OpenSSH is a robust and secure implementation of the SSH protocol, widely used for secure remote login and data transfer. It supports advanced features like public key authentication, port forwarding, and tunneling. Ideal for large enterprises needing secure network access and file transfers.

Zscaler Zero Trust Network Access

Zscaler's Zero Trust Network Access (ZTNA) is a cloud-delivered service that enforces zero-trust principles for secure access to applications and resources. It provides advanced threat protection, granular access controls, and visibility into network traffic. Ideal for enterprises requiring robust security measures across hybrid and multi-cloud environments.
